public final class TemperatureQuantity extends AbstractQuantity<javax.measure.quantity.Temperature> implements javax.measure.quantity.Temperature
| Constructor and Description |
|---|
TemperatureQuantity(double val,
TemperatureUnit un) |
TemperatureQuantity(Number val,
javax.measure.Unit u) |
| Modifier and Type | Method and Description |
|---|---|
javax.measure.Quantity<javax.measure.quantity.Temperature> |
add(javax.measure.Quantity<javax.measure.quantity.Temperature> that) |
TemperatureQuantity |
add(TemperatureQuantity d1) |
int |
compareTo(javax.measure.Quantity<javax.measure.quantity.Temperature> o) |
protected TemperatureQuantity |
convert(TemperatureUnit newUnit) |
TemperatureQuantity |
divide(double v) |
javax.measure.Quantity<javax.measure.quantity.Temperature> |
divide(Number that) |
javax.measure.Quantity<?> |
divide(javax.measure.Quantity<?> that) |
protected double |
doubleValue(javax.measure.Unit<javax.measure.quantity.Temperature> unit) |
protected boolean |
eq(AbstractQuantity<javax.measure.quantity.Temperature> dq) |
protected boolean |
eq(TemperatureQuantity dq) |
boolean |
ge(TemperatureQuantity d1) |
Double |
getScalar() |
javax.measure.Unit<javax.measure.quantity.Temperature> |
getUnit() |
Number |
getValue() |
javax.measure.Quantity<javax.measure.quantity.Temperature> |
inverse() |
boolean |
isZero() |
boolean |
le(TemperatureQuantity d1) |
boolean |
lt(TemperatureQuantity d1) |
javax.measure.Quantity<javax.measure.quantity.Temperature> |
multiply(Number that) |
javax.measure.Quantity<?> |
multiply(javax.measure.Quantity<?> that) |
javax.measure.Quantity<javax.measure.quantity.Temperature> |
negate() |
String |
showInUnit(javax.measure.Unit<?> u,
int precision,
UnitStyle style) |
javax.measure.Quantity<javax.measure.quantity.Temperature> |
subtract(javax.measure.Quantity<javax.measure.quantity.Temperature> that) |
TemperatureQuantity |
subtract(TemperatureQuantity d1) |
javax.measure.Quantity<javax.measure.quantity.Temperature> |
to(javax.measure.Unit<javax.measure.quantity.Temperature> unit) |
String |
toString(boolean withUnit,
boolean withSpace,
int precision) |
asType, equals, getScale, getStr, hashCode, isEquivalentTo, showInUnit, showInUnit, showInUnit, toString, toString, toString, toStringpublic TemperatureQuantity(double val, TemperatureUnit un)
public TemperatureQuantity(Number val, javax.measure.Unit u)
public boolean isZero()
isZero in class AbstractQuantity<javax.measure.quantity.Temperature>public TemperatureQuantity add(TemperatureQuantity d1)
public TemperatureQuantity subtract(TemperatureQuantity d1)
protected boolean eq(TemperatureQuantity dq)
public boolean lt(TemperatureQuantity d1)
public boolean ge(TemperatureQuantity d1)
public boolean le(TemperatureQuantity d1)
public TemperatureQuantity divide(double v)
protected TemperatureQuantity convert(TemperatureUnit newUnit)
public Double getScalar()
getScalar in class AbstractQuantity<javax.measure.quantity.Temperature>public String toString(boolean withUnit, boolean withSpace, int precision)
toString in class AbstractQuantity<javax.measure.quantity.Temperature>public String showInUnit(javax.measure.Unit<?> u, int precision, UnitStyle style)
showInUnit in class AbstractQuantity<javax.measure.quantity.Temperature>public Number getValue()
getValue in interface javax.measure.Quantity<javax.measure.quantity.Temperature>public javax.measure.Unit<javax.measure.quantity.Temperature> getUnit()
getUnit in interface javax.measure.Quantity<javax.measure.quantity.Temperature>public javax.measure.Quantity<javax.measure.quantity.Temperature> multiply(Number that)
multiply in interface javax.measure.Quantity<javax.measure.quantity.Temperature>public javax.measure.Quantity<?> multiply(javax.measure.Quantity<?> that)
multiply in interface javax.measure.Quantity<javax.measure.quantity.Temperature>public javax.measure.Quantity<javax.measure.quantity.Temperature> inverse()
inverse in interface javax.measure.Quantity<javax.measure.quantity.Temperature>protected double doubleValue(javax.measure.Unit<javax.measure.quantity.Temperature> unit)
public javax.measure.Quantity<javax.measure.quantity.Temperature> to(javax.measure.Unit<javax.measure.quantity.Temperature> unit)
to in interface javax.measure.Quantity<javax.measure.quantity.Temperature>to in interface tech.uom.lib.common.function.QuantityConverter<javax.measure.quantity.Temperature>protected boolean eq(AbstractQuantity<javax.measure.quantity.Temperature> dq)
eq in class AbstractQuantity<javax.measure.quantity.Temperature>public javax.measure.Quantity<?> divide(javax.measure.Quantity<?> that)
divide in interface javax.measure.Quantity<javax.measure.quantity.Temperature>public javax.measure.Quantity<javax.measure.quantity.Temperature> subtract(javax.measure.Quantity<javax.measure.quantity.Temperature> that)
subtract in interface javax.measure.Quantity<javax.measure.quantity.Temperature>public javax.measure.Quantity<javax.measure.quantity.Temperature> add(javax.measure.Quantity<javax.measure.quantity.Temperature> that)
add in interface javax.measure.Quantity<javax.measure.quantity.Temperature>public javax.measure.Quantity<javax.measure.quantity.Temperature> divide(Number that)
divide in interface javax.measure.Quantity<javax.measure.quantity.Temperature>public int compareTo(javax.measure.Quantity<javax.measure.quantity.Temperature> o)
compareTo in interface Comparable<javax.measure.Quantity<javax.measure.quantity.Temperature>>public javax.measure.Quantity<javax.measure.quantity.Temperature> negate()
negate in interface javax.measure.Quantity<javax.measure.quantity.Temperature>Copyright © 2005–2024 Units of Measurement project. All rights reserved.